  1. East Course Tour

  : This is the most popular and recommended itinerary for first-time visitors to Jeju island. It covers the main highlights and landmarks of the island,  

    -. San-Gum-Bu-Ri Crater (discountable)

        : It was designated as a natural monument on June 21, 1979.  Depth 100~146m.  Diameter: 544m east-west, 450m north-south.  Outer circumference: 2,067m.  The inner circumference is 756m.  It has a similar appearance to Baeknokdam, a crater lake that developed at the peak around the same time as the creation of Hallasan Mountain.  When you look at Sangumburi from the sky, it seems as if you are seeing an artificially created circular playground in the middle of the vast surrounding woodland.

     -. Wol-Jeong Beach

        : Woljeong-ri, a village located in the east of Jeju Island, is a village with a lyrical scenery whose name means the moon stays.  The beautiful emerald sea spreads out like a painting, and a bright moon shines above it.  Travelers who visit Woljeongri Beach, which is as beautiful as a landscape painting, enjoy the beach scenery in various ways.  In particular, because the water depth is relatively shallow, it is good for families with children to enjoy water play.  As the beautiful scenery of Woljeong-ri became more and more famous among travelers, the number of people visiting Woljeong-ri's beaches increased, and accordingly, many various restaurants, cafes, and lodging facilities were opened.  Some cafes placed chairs so that people could relax while looking at the sea, and as photos taken of people sitting on these chairs became famous, they also became a photo spot.

     -. Gim-Nyeong Yacht Tour (discountable)

        : ​Gimnyeong Yacht Tour, located at Gimnyeong Port, Gimnyeong-ri, Gujwa-eup, Jeju-si, is an experience of cruising the waters of Jeju aboard the luxury yacht “BONA” with top-class interior facilities.  You can experience real sailing, sailing powered solely by the wind, on a yacht operated by a former national yachtsman.  Wild raw fish, seasonal fruits, refreshments, and beverages are also provided.  The area off Gimnyeong is a dolphin habitat and is where dolphins appear most frequently during yacht tours.  Under the sea of ​​Gimnyeong, there is an underwater mountain called ‘Duruksan Mountain.’  Because of the abundance of fish species here, it is also perfect for boat fishing.

     -. Manjang Lava Cave (not available currently)

       : Manjanggul Cave is a lava cave located in Gujwa-eup, Jeju-si, Jeju-do, South Korea, and is part of the Geomun Oreum lava tube system.  The total length of the cave system is about 15km, of which Manjanggul Cave is about 7.416km long, making it the 12th longest lava tube in the world.  It is registered as a UNESCO World Heritage Site and a Natural Monument of Korea.

     -. Gimnyeong M aze P ark (discountable)

        : ​​Mazeland is the world's longest stone maze park created with the theme of Jeju Island's Samda, which is wind, water, and women.  The wind maze is planted with 2,709 cypress trees, which are rich in phytoncide, and the women's maze is planted with 2,922 camellia trees and ralandii trees, which bloom red flowers in winter.  The final level of difficulty, the stone maze, has a mysterious atmosphere that wouldn't be out of place even if a magician pops out.

     -. Rail Bike (discountable)

       : ​Jeju Rail Bike is one of the leisure tours that allows you to enjoy the scenery while riding a four-wheeled bicycle on a railroad track. Not only can you view the oreums around Gujwa-eup, Udo Island, and Seongsan Ilchulbong Peak, but also the ranch. Since it is operated together, you can admire about 100 cows grazing.  It runs every 30 minutes from the top of the hour, and it takes about 35 minutes to complete the trail.  Because it moves forward automatically using an electric motor rather than directly pedaling, you can ride it without any effort.  There is a windbreak so you can ride comfortably even in rainy weather.  In addition to rail bikes, there are plenty of other things to enjoy, including cafes, animal farms, and observatories.  If you climb up to the observatory located on the second floor, you can enjoy the scenery of the rail bike and the ranch with Yongnuni Oreum in the background.  The cafe also sells carrot juice made from ground carrots, a Gujwa specialty.​​​​​​​​

    -. Aqua Planet (discountable)

        : Aqua Planet Jeju is Asia's largest aquarium (total area of ​​25,600 m², 18,000 tons).  This is approximately 11 times the size of 63 Sea World and has the world's largest single tank.  The 48,000 exhibits of over 500 species are also among the world's top 10.  Aqua Planet Jeju, which claims to be an 'amusement theme park' where you can enjoy education, culture, and entertainment at the same time, has a very large aquarium 'Jeju Sea' that reproduces the sea in front of Jeju, a 'Marine Science Experience Center', and a 'Large Marine Performance Hall'.     -. Hae- N yeo Museum

        : It displays materials on the ocean, fishing villages, folklore, and fishing, focusing on Jeju's haenyeo culture, which has a history dating back to BC.  All exhibits inside and outside the museum were donated by female divers.  Inside the exhibition hall, an actual haenyeo's house has been donated and relocated, and food culture, parenting, half-urban farming, and Yeongdeung-gut culture are on display in detail.  The approximately 7-minute video is definitely worth watching. The garden in front of the museum was the secondary gathering place for haenyeo who participated in the January 1932 protest, the anti-Japanese women's anti-Japanese movement and the largest women's anti-Japanese movement in Korea.  The Jeju Haenyeo Anti-Japanese Movement Monument was erected there to commemorate the spirit of the women divers' anti-Japanese movement, showing the strength of Jeju women's lives.

     -. Han-Lim Park (discountable)

       : It is a private park that was established in 1971 by purchasing a wasteland sand field on the beach of Hyeopjae-ri and planting palm trees and ornamental trees.  In 1981, the exit of Hyeopjae Cave, which was buried within the park, was dug out and Ssangyong Cave was excavated. The two caves were connected and opened to the public in October 1983.  In 1986, the Subtropical Botanical Garden was completed, and the Jaeam Folk Village was opened in 1987, the Chief Exhibition Hall in 1996, and the Jeju Stone Bonsai Garden in 1997.

     -. Yong-Doo-Am (Dragon head rock)

       : Yongduam Rock is a well-known tourist destination located on the coast of Yongdam-dong, Jeju City.  There is a high cliff near Yongduam Rock, and the terrain is gentle to the east and west, so it is assumed that thick lava flowed.  If you look at Yongduam from the side, it looks like a dragon's head, but if you look down from a high place, it looks like a long thin plate.  Additionally, fist-sized round stones are embedded in the surface of the rock that forms Yongduam. These are clinkers that were created when lava flowed, and as they were pushed down a long distance, their size became smaller and their shape was worn away.

     -. Eco-Land Theme Park  (discountable)

        : Ecoland is a theme park where you can ride a train modeled after the Baldwin model, a steam locomotive from the 1800s, and experience Gotjawal, about 4.5 km away. Gotjawal is a Jeju word that is a combination of ‘Got’, meaning forest, and ‘Jawal’, meaning stone field. , refers to a unique forest formed when a volcano erupts and the lava is split into chunks, creating an uneven terrain.  It is a place of high academic value as it has high thermal insulation and moisturizing effects, and plants from various climate zones coexist. It is a place with a unique atmosphere where vitality and mystery can be observed.  Eco Land is divided into stations with different themes.     -. Soe-Sok-Kak Estuary  

       : This is a place where water flowing underground in Jeju basalt erupted and met sea water to form a deep puddle.  The name Soesokkak is a dialect of Jeju Island.  Soe means Hyodon Village, So means a pond, and Gak is a suffix meaning the end.  It is known as a place with beautiful scenery of the valley and excellent unexplored scenery.

     -. Jeong-Bang Water Fall

       : This waterfall developed at the southern foot of Hallasan Mountain and is the only coastal waterfall in Asia where the water falls into the sea.  It is even more beautiful when viewed from a distance in the summer.  BC. A man named Seobok (Seobul), who came to visit the hermit who lived in Yeongju Mountain (Halla Mountain) at the order of Emperor Qin Shi Huang of China, was so impressed by the scenery of the waterfall that he engraved the words ‘Seobul passes by here’ on the cliff of the waterfall and returned. This is why. There is a story that the name Seogwipo was created.

    -. D ae-Po Columnar Joints  

       : The sight of waves crashing between hexagonal stone pillars stacked on top of each other and towering like a castle is like a painting.  Jisatgae Coast's columnar joints are made up of square to hexagonal rocks about 30 meters high that form a sheer cliff along a coast that is about 1 km long.

Global Taxi

Global taxis are taxis for foreigners that have been designated by the Jeju Special Self-Governing Province. The taxi drivers will directly provide guidance in a foreign language (English, Chinese, Japanese). Currently, there are 19 English taxis, 26 Chinese taxis, and 60 Japanese taxis. Global taxis give foreigners travelling to Jeju alone a way to travel around conveniently and tour Jeju during their visit. They are also employed by cruise travellers who wish to tour for half a day or the whole day.
